I bought this Cartier 1895 ring in US a couple of months ago, but only realise today that there are TWO 'marks'/'dents?' on the outside of the ring (near bottom), one on each side.

Are those marks there on purpose?

Isn't this supposed to be 'plain' and 'smooth' platinum ring?

The French hallmark their rings on the outside of the band rather than the inside like we do, if you look closely it's probebly a little eagals head and a makers mark for Cartier. Is this what your seeing? If it is that's totally normal.

The eagle's head is for gold (18K). The French platinum hallmark is a dog's head (looks like a greyhound to me, but couldn't be sure.)
